IS IT POSSIBLE TO RECEIVE A PAYDAY LOAN THE SAME DAY?

If youre in a pinch financially, a same-day payday loan can help you meet your immediate demands until your next paycheck arrives.

However, youll almost certainly pay a price for the convenience of short-term loans payday loans are known for high fees and triple-digit interest rates. When it comes to payday loans, its not uncommon to pay costs that amount to roughly 400 percent APRs (annual percentage rates). Payday lenders typically give modest sums of money, usually $500 or less, with payback due on your next payday, however, terms differ by state.

Same-day funding is a selling pitch for payday lenders, but it doesnt always imply youll get your money the same day as loan application. The time it takes for you to get funds varies depending on the lender.

The disadvantages of same-day payday loans

  • APRs and high fees: Payday lenders who promote cheap costs should be avoided since they might build up to a very high interest rate. A $15 cost every $100 borrowed is standard, according to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au. For a two-week loan, that equates to an APR of about 400 percent. According to the Federal Reserve, the average interest rate on a 24-month personal loan was 10.63 percent in May 2019, while the average credit card interest rate was 15.13 percent. Filling a financial shortfall with a personal loan or credit card may be a less expensive option.
  • Debt cycle possibility: Payday loans can trap you in a cycle of debt that is tough to escape. According to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, four out of every five payday loans are reborrowed within a month, putting you at risk of incurring even more costs. You may end yourself paying more in fees than you borrowed in the end.
  • This isnt a long-term fix: Create an emergency savings reserve if you can to use when unexpected bills arise. If borrowing small amounts of money on a regular basis becomes habitual, you may find yourself relying on debt rather than addressing underlying issues.

What other options do I have besides a same-day payday loan?

When you need money quickly, payday loans arent your only option. Comparing payday loans to alternatives will assist you in making the best decision for your situation.

Use a credit card you already have.

If you already have a credit card, you might want to use it while youre in need of cash. Interest rates on your present credit cards may be far lower than those on payday loans.

Apply for a payday loan that isnt a payday loan.

Some federal credit unions provide payday alternative loans with a $20 maximum application cost. Loan amounts range from $200 to $1,000, with durations ranging from one to six months.

To apply, you must have been a member of the credit union for at least one month.

Make an application for a small-dollar personal loan.

An unsecured personal loan is repaid over a predetermined length of time in monthly installments. The length of the loan varies per lender, but it usually ranges from 24 to 84 months, allowing you plenty of time to pay it off.

Consider taking out a cash advance.

A cash advance allows you to borrow money against the available balance on your credit card. Cash advances, on the other hand, usually come with higher processing fees and interest rates than regular credit card purchases.

The laws and regulations governing payday loans differ from state to state. Some states dont allow same-day payday loans at all, while others have strict guidelines on how much payday lenders can lend and how much they can charge to let you borrow.

Its a good idea to verify your states regulations and study internet reviews before taking out a payday loan. Also, keep in mind that you have alternative borrowing options to consider before taking out a payday loan.
